The Vocabulary We Build Your Miami SEO Around

Real-estate-agent marketing fails when it just buys leads from the portals and calls it a strategy. Agents who scale build a sphere, farm a neighborhood, and use marketing to compound both. Here's what we know about how a Miami real-estate agent or team actually grows GCI, so your marketing builds the brand the portals can't take away from you.

Sphere of influence
The 100 to 250 people who already know you. Past clients, family, neighbors, school parents. Sphere conversion is 8 to 15 times portal-lead conversion.
Farming
Geographic neighborhood targeting through repetition (mailers, door hangers, sponsored open houses, neighborhood content). The compounding play that beats portal-buying long-term.
Expired listing
A listing that came off the MLS without selling. A highly targetable lead segment with its own outreach cadence.
